官方数据接口是指由政府机构、权威组织或企业官方发布的,用于应用程序之间数据交换和信息交互的标准通道。这些接口以API(Application Programming Interface)的形式存在,允许外部系统以规范的格式请求和接收官方数据,确保数据的准确性和可靠性。官方数据接口的使用,不仅简化了数据获取的流程,还提高了数据应用的效率和安全性。
官方数据接口具有以下几个显著特点:
官方数据接口的应用场景广泛,涵盖了多个领域:
API,即Application Programming Interface,是一种软件中间件,它定义了操作系统或不同软件程序之间如何通信。在官方数据接口的应用中,API充当了一个桥梁的角色,使得不同系统间的数据交互成为可能。其工作原理基于一系列预定义的规则和协议,这些规则和协议描述了数据的格式、调用的方法以及预期的响应。当一个应用程序需要从另一个系统获取数据或执行某些操作时,它通过调用API,发送特定的请求,API则负责解析请求,与目标系统进行通信,并将结果返回给请求方。
在官方数据接口的应用场景中,如国家统计局的数据查询API,其原理是通过HTTP协议,使用GET或POST方法发送请求至指定的URL。请求中包含了必要的参数,如查询类型、数据类别等。服务器接收到请求后,根据参数执行相应的数据检索或计算,然后将结果封装成JSON或XML格式返回给客户端。这一过程实现了数据的无缝对接,无需直接访问底层数据库,简化了数据获取的过程,同时也保护了数据的安全性。
数据交互的技术架构通常涉及多个层面,包括前端应用、API网关、后端服务以及数据存储层。前端应用通过API调用发起数据请求,API网关作为中间层接收请求,进行身份验证、权限检查、负载均衡等一系列处理,然后将请求转发给后端服务。后端服务接收到请求后,根据业务逻辑处理数据,最后将处理结果返回给API网关,API网关再将结果传送给前端应用。
在官方数据接口中,如统计数据分析查询API,其技术架构尤为关键。它要求高度的可靠性、安全性以及高性能。为了满足这些需求,架构设计通常会采用微服务模式,将复杂的服务拆分成独立的小服务,每个小服务专注于单一功能,如数据检索、数据处理、权限验证等。这种架构不仅提高了系统的可维护性和可扩展性,还能够灵活应对高并发请求,确保数据的实时性和准确性。
官方数据接口的安全机制是确保数据安全和隐私的关键。它包括但不限于身份验证、加密传输、权限控制以及审计跟踪等措施。身份验证确保只有合法的用户或应用才能访问接口,常用的方法有OAuth2.0、JWT等。加密传输则通过HTTPS协议,对数据传输过程进行加密,防止数据在传输过程中被截获和篡改。权限控制根据用户角色和权限级别,限制对特定数据的访问,确保数据的访问符合法律法规和企业政策。审计跟踪记录所有API调用的细节,包括调用者、调用时间、调用参数和响应结果,以便于追踪异常行为和进行合规性审计。
例如,在银行卡归属地查询的API接口中,由于涉及到敏感的金融信息,安全机制尤为重要。除了基本的身份验证和权限控制,还采用了加密技术对敏感数据进行保护,确保即使数据在传输过程中被截获,也无法被非法解密和利用。同时,严格的审计机制确保每一次调用都被记录,一旦发生安全事件,可以迅速定位问题源头,采取相应措施。
官方数据接口在各行业的应用呈现出前所未有的广泛性和深度。在金融领域,银行、证券和保险机构利用官方数据接口进行实时交易、风险管理及合规检查,如通过股票历史数据分析查询接口,金融机构能够获取详尽的股票交易数据,进行市场分析和投资决策。在电商领域,商家通过电商平台API数据接口,实现订单管理、库存同步和支付处理等功能,极大提升了运营效率。物流行业则依赖于全球快递查询接口,确保货物跟踪的准确性和时效性。此外,政府机构如国家统计局提供的数据查询API,为经济研究者、政策制定者和公众提供了宏观经济指标的即时访问,助力于经济分析和决策。
官方数据接口的发展趋势正朝着更加开放、智能化和标准化的方向演进。随着大数据、云计算和人工智能技术的进步,官方数据接口不仅提供静态数据,还支持实时数据流,使数据获取更加高效。例如,天气预报接口结合了机器学习技术,能够预测未来40天的天气情况,为农业、旅游等行业提供决策支持。同时,接口的标准化和规范化成为趋势,如统一采用JSON数据格式,增强了跨平台的兼容性和数据的可读性。此外,安全性增强也是发展趋势之一,官方数据接口开始采用加密技术和身份验证机制,保护数据安全和用户隐私。
尽管官方数据接口带来了诸多便利,但也面临着一系列挑战与机遇。挑战方面,数据隐私和安全是首要关注点,特别是在个人信息处理上,如身份证实名核验接口需严格遵守相关法规,防止数据泄露。另外,数据质量与实时性是另一个挑战,官方数据接口需要确保数据的准确性和更新速度,以满足用户需求。然而,这些挑战也孕育了机遇,如通过技术升级和规范制定,可以推动数据接口服务的创新和成熟,同时,数据接口市场的扩大吸引了众多服务商加入,促进了市场竞争和技术创新,为用户提供更多元化、更优质的服务。
官方数据接口作为现代信息化社会的重要组成部分,为各个行业提供了便捷的数据获取途径。API(Application Programming Interface)技术的应用,使得信息交互变得高效且标准化,极大地推动了技术创新与行业发展。无论是企业还是个人开发者,都能通过官方接口轻松实现技术接入,解锁海量数据资源。
在6000字的文章中,我们详细探讨了官方接口的定义、类型及其在不同领域中的应用。首先,我们阐述了官方接口如何作为一座桥梁,连接数据提供者和使用者,确保数据的安全传输与合法使用。接着,文章深入剖析了API的工作原理,尤其是RESTful API的设计理念,强调其在简化数据获取过程中的关键作用。
文章进一步讨论了数据获取的重要性,特别是在大数据时代,官方接口如何帮助企业快速响应市场变化,提升决策效率。同时,我们也介绍了API在移动应用、社交媒体、物联网以及科学研究等领域的广泛应用案例,展示了接口技术的强大潜力。
为了帮助所有读者理解并掌握API应用,文章特别设置了专门章节,详细解析了技术接入的步骤和注意事项,包括认证机制、错误处理和性能优化等方面。此外,我们还讨论了隐私保护和合规性问题,提醒用户在利用官方接口时应遵循的法律法规。
而言,官方数据接口不仅是信息时代的关键基础设施,也是驱动社会进步的无形力量。通过理解和掌握API技术,无论是专业人士还是业余爱好者,都能在这个数据驱动的世界中找到属于自己的创新之路。